Casario do Porto |
Casario do Porto is protected by Instituto do Patrimônio Histórico e
Artístico Nacional since 1992 and, today, is one of the most demanded touristic spots of Corumbá, being recognized as one of the main
postcards of the city. The buildings that formed the complex had bank agencies, tannery, and the first ice fabric of Brazil. Today it
houses the Secretaria Municipal do Meio Ambiente e Turismo (Municipal Secretary of Environment and Tourism) and the Fundação de
Cultura do Pantanal (Pantanal’s Culture Foundation).
Most of the place was finished by the end of the 19th century and has
rooms considered the most elegant of the epoch. |
